EDITORS COMMENTS
This powerful image captures a moment in history that is both haunting and significant. The scene depicts African-American workers picking cotton on a plantation beside the Mississippi River in 1883. In the background, we see the imposing plantation house to the left, with workers' cabins lined up to its right.
The jetty in the center of the image serves as a reminder of how vital cotton was to the economy at that time, with bales being loaded onto paddle steamers for transport. The landscape is vast and seemingly endless, highlighting the backbreaking labor that these individuals endured day in and day out.
This chromolithograph not only showcases the physical work involved in agriculture and textile production but also speaks volumes about race relations and social hierarchy during this period in American history. It serves as a stark reminder of our country's dark past and challenges us to reflect on how far we have come since then.
